Bug#941618: torus-trooper: fails to start with "undefined symbol" error

This isn't just torus-trooper, many other libgphobos reverse
dependencies are affected:

dustmite
gunroar
mu-cade
parsec47
projectl
titanion
torus-trooper
tumiki-fighters
val-and-rick

> Le 02/10/2019 23:37, Cédric Boutillier a écrit :
> > I've just installed the game and tried to launch it from the terminal:
> > I got the following error message:
> >
> > torus-trooper: symbol lookup error: torus-trooper: undefined symbol:
> > _D4core4stdc5errno5errnoFNbNdNiNeZ
>
> This is a symbol in libgdruntime.so.76.0.2 which is no longer present in
> libgdruntime.so.76.0.3. It does look like an internal symbol, but
> binaries apparently end up with references to it, so binaries built with
> the GCC 8 version can break with the GCC 9 version...
>
> Should this be fixed in GCC, or by binNMUing?
